- Setting Up a Priority Inbox
The Priority Inbox feature categorizes emails into three sections: Important and Unread, Starred, and Everything Else.
Go to Settings > Inbox and select Priority Inbox.
Gmail automatically identifies important emails based on your interactions, but you can manually adjust this by clicking the yellow importance marker (a small arrow).
- Setting Up Gmail Labels and Filters
Labels in Gmail are tags that you can apply to emails to categorize them. Unlike folders, an email can have multiple labels, allowing for more flexible organization. While, filters are those that are automatically sort incoming emails based on criteria like sender, subject, or keywords. They can apply labels, archive, or forward emails automatically, helping you manage your inbox efficiently.
1) How to Create and Apply Labels
- Go to the left-hand sidebar of Gmail and scroll down to find "Create new label."
- Name your label (e.g., "Work," "Family," or "Projects").
- Once created, you can manually apply labels by selecting emails and clicking the "Label" icon.
- For easier management, apply color codes to labels for visual distinction.
2) Using Filters for Automation
When learning how to organize Gmail inbox, A filter assists in categorizing incoming e-mail to specific labels or folders according to option set.
- Go to Settings > Filters and Blocked Addresses > Create a New Filter.
- Set criteria like sender, keywords, or subject line.
- Choose actions like applying a label, marking as read, or archiving.
- Using Categories and Tabs for Quick Access
Gmail’s default inbox sorts your emails into five tabs: Primary, Social, Promotions, Updates, and Forums. Learning how to organize emails in Gmail with these tabs helps separate personal messages from newsletters and other less important emails, making it easier to manage your inbox.
You can control which tabs appear in your inbox:
- Go to Settings > Inbox.
- Under Categories, check or uncheck the tabs you want.
This method helps streamline your primary inbox, so only personal or high-priority emails appear there.
- Archiving and Snoozing Emails
When you delete your emails in Gmail from your inbox, you completely get free of the emails, while in the case of archiving you are only moving the emails from the inbox to the ‘All Mail’ section but you still get to see the emails if you click on the ‘All Mail’ tab. This is useful if you want to maintain a tidy inbox but don't want to erase your emails or texts.
- To archive an email, you just need to highlight the email and then click the “Archive” bar.
The Snooze feature is one in which an email can be taken out of the inbox and placed back in after some time.
- Simply move the pointer over the email and click the clock icon to snooze it. Choose a time and date for its detailed reappearance.
- Using the Search Function Efficiently
When figuring out how to organize Gmail inbox, Gmail's advanced search operators help you locate specific emails quickly. Some useful operators include:
from: – To search emails from a specific sender (e.g., from:[email protected]).
subject: – To find emails by subject line.
has: – To find emails with attachments.
If you frequently search for specific kinds of emails, you can turn your searches into filters to sort future messages into labels or folders automatically.
